AIRCRAFT COMPONENT MRO MARKET OVERVIEW

The global aircraft component MRO market size was USD 14.54 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 18.78 billion by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 2.87% during the forecast period 2025–2034.

Aircraft Component MRO (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ul) includes specialized services that are needed to maintain individual aircraft components like landing gear, avionics, flight control systems, and other hydraulic and electrical components in airworthy condition. Such operations play an important role in maintaining the safety, reliability, and long durability of aircraft as they may require complicated inspection, repairing, and replacing processes that are imposed by stringent aviation regulations. The industry is a core component of the wider aviation MRO sector because it is motivated by such factors as an aging global aircraft fleet, and high regulatory standards regarding airworthiness. It is shifted to the predictive maintenance, and the use of technology, such as AI and data analytics, is used to optimize the repair schedule, reduce aircraft downtime, and cost-effectively manage airlines and operators.

Aircraft Component MRO Market is a large and expanding part of the world aviation aftermarket, worth tens of billions of US dollars every year. It has a high global usage and its services are vital to the commercial (passenger and cargo) and military aviation industries of the globe. Although other regions such as North America and Europe are currently experiencing a significant Aircraft Component MRO Market Share given the availability of major airlines and Aircraft MRO providers, Asia-Pacific region is expected to record the highest growth rates with the rise in air traffic, growth in fleet and increased investment in MRO capabilities. One of the prominent tendencies within the market is the tendency to transfer these specialized services to third-party MROs operating independently and to the facilities of the OEM affiliated to gain their specialized background and to manage their operational processes in a more efficient manner.

COVID-19 IMPACT

The Aircraft Component MRO Industry Had a Negative Effect Due to Factory Closures During the COVID-19 Pandemic

The global COVID-19 pandemic has been unprecedented and staggering, with the market experiencing lower-than-anticipated demand across all regions compared to pre-pandemic levels. The sudden growth reflected by the rise in CAGR is attributable to the market’s growth and demand returning to pre-pandemic levels.

The Aircraft Component MRO Market had suffered the most devastating shock brought about by the COVID-19 pandemic. With air travel demand worldwide crashing, thousands of aircraft were grounded or stored by the airlines directly leading to an unprecedented sudden sharp fall in MRO demand which is largely flight-hour and flight-cycle driven. Maintenance of components through which the aircraft are utilized was closely related to the utilization of the aircrafts and the expenditure reduced drastically as carriers postponed unnecessary upkeep and were trying to save cash. This crisis increased the pace of retiring older, less fuel-efficient planes, saturating the market with Used Serviceable Material in teardowns, which artificially reduced the demand on new parts to be manufactured as well as on a timeline of overhaul. Although the market remains in the robust recovery stage, with expenditure almost at its usual level, the crisis fundamentally changed the strategies, forcing MRO providers to focus on digitization, predictive maintenance, further flexibility in the global fleet to cope with volatility and the long-term changes in the global fleet.

LATEST TRENDS

Digital Transformation and Predictive Maintenance (PdM) to Drive Market Growth

The latest trend in the Component MRO market is the integration of the Digital Transformation and Predictive Maintenance. This entails the use of sensors, AI, and Machine Learning to step out of scheduled maintenance and be able to monitor the health of components and their performance in real-time. PdM, which works on operational data, is able to predict component failure with high precision and hence the MRO providers can plan their repairs to work when required, not in response to some failure or based on a fixed time schedule. Such a change will cause minimal aircraft unscheduled downtime, enhance operational efficiency and be the key in lifecycle cost management of high-value parts in the Market.

AIRCRAFT COMPONENT MRO MARKET SEGMENTATION

By Type

Based on Type, the global market can be categorized into Fuselage, Empennage, Landing Gear, Wings, Engine, Others.

  • Fuselage: The Fuselage segment of MRO involves structural repairs, corrosion control and interior cabin refurbishment done during major airframe checks.
  • Empennage: Empennage maintenance is done in the form of the detailed structural examination and repair of the horizontal and vertical stabilizers which provide directional stability and integrity of flight control.
  • Landing Gear: The Landing Gear segment is marked by intricate overhaul and restoration, which have time-based procedures, owing to the cycles of high frequency and harsh regulatory requirements of safety.
  • Wings: Wings MRO involves structural soundness and surface repair of the main lifting surfaces such as damages of flaps, ailerons and high lift devices affecting aerodynamic performance.
  • Engine: Engine category is the most specialized and largest market segment as it is motivated by expensive and high-tech MROs, engine health check and replacement of parts of the complicated propulsion systems.
  • Others: The others category covers MRO of all auxiliary systems and advanced electronics (including avionics, auxiliary power units (APU), electrical and hydraulic systems) which are more and more being serviced through highly advanced component repair shops.

By Application

Based on the Application, the global market can be categorized into Commercial Air Transport, Business and General Aviation, Military Aviation.

  • Commercial Air Transport: This is the biggest segment of the MRO market where fleet utilization, strict international compliance with regulatory requirements and passenger and cargo traffic cycles are the main factors of component maintenance.
  • Business and General Aviation: MRO in Business and General Aviation entails highly customized services to smaller groups of private jets, turboprops and helicopters and is concerned with customized component repairs, luxury cabin interior updates, and rapid turnaround services required by high-net-worth operators.
  • Military Aviation: The Military Aviation segment is marked by the MRO services imposed by the government defense budgets, the need to ensure operational readiness and mission capability, and the specific component repair of old and complex platforms with high-security measures.

Driving Factors

Aging Global Fleet & Flight Hours to Boost the Market

Aging Global Fleet & Flight Hours is a major factor in the Aircraft Component MRO Market Growth. With the new aircraft deliveries still experiencing a production backlog, airlines have been compelled to increase the lifespan of their old and older fleet which, by nature, necessitates more regular and more complex maintenance. Such intense use of airplanes of advanced age, along with a successful post-pandemic recovery of air travel volumes, contributes to the rapid degradation of the condition of parts that are hard to repair, increasing the number of heavy inspections and engine repair visits. This aspect, in turn, directly and efficiently drives a good demand in the Aircraft Component MRO Market, particularly in structural repairs and overhauls.

Adoption of Predictive Maintenance to Expand the Market

Adoption of Predictive Maintenance (PdM) is a significant aspect that is about to grow and redefine the Component MRO market. With the help of sensors, data analytics, and Artificial Intelligence, now MRO providers are able to start more of a transition to a reactive or time-based maintenance into diagnosing component health in real-time. This can be used to ensure that maintenance is planned at the exact right time, which leads to a significant reduction of unscheduled aircraft grounding, decreases the risk of component failures, and makes the overall MRO operations efficient. The consequent effect of the increased life of the components and shortened downtime is a major motivational point to invest and spur the market sophistication.

Restraining Factor

Skilled Workforce Shortage Impedes Market Growth

The Skilled Workforce Shortage is a throbbing burden on the Component MRO market that literally hinders its growth ability. The imbalance is severe in specialty fields such as engine and avionics repair due to the ageing workforce, who are about to retire, and a lack of a new, skilled workforce to replace them. This shortage has caused increased labor expenses, long turnaround times (TAT) on components, and causes MRO facilities to be working full time with no capacity to rapidly increase to meet high demands as ageing fleets cause demand spikes. This constraint is ultimately a significant bottleneck in terms of restricting the volume of services and operational adaptability of Aircraft Component MRO Market.

Additive Manufacturing (3D Printing) Opportunities in the Market

Opportunity

There is a major prospect of changing Aircraft Component MRO Market using Additive Manufacturing (3D Printing). The technology enables the MRO providers to manufacture non-critical, low volume spare parts, tools and specialized repair fixtures at a high speed on demand, at the very location of the maintenance facility.

Through localized component manufacturing, 3D printing can significantly decrease the use of long supply chains in global OEMs, resulting in the reduced inventory holding costs and the reduction of AOG (Aircraft on Ground) impacts caused by the lack of parts. Moreover, it allows executing changes in components faster and find solutions to repairs, which makes MRO more responsive to urgent operational requirements, agile, and cost-effective.

Market Growth Icon

High Component and Service Costs Could Be a Potential Challenge

Challenge

High Component and Service Costs is one of the existing and significant challenges facing consumers mostly airlines in the Component MRO market. These excessive prices are also significantly fuelled by the monopoly over intellectual property that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) tend to have on the proprietary parts that restricts competition and increases the prices on spares and required repair services.

Moreover, the growing complexity of the next-generation aircraft systems and the high regulation compliance requirements require highly specialized and thus, costly MRO procedures. Therefore, the large amount of money spent on maintenance of the components continues to be an issue of financial pressure to the airlines that directly affects the operational budgets and profitability of the airlines.

AIRCRAFT COMPONENT MRO MARKET REGIONAL INSIGHTS

  • North America

The Aircraft Component MRO Market Share in North America is predominant, with a huge, mature, and old commercial fleet, and a large military aviation industry worldwide. Major OEMs and leading MRO providers of the region, especially the United States Aircraft Component MRO Market, create the environment of high technological adoption, predictive maintenance, and advanced digital tools. The demand is always high and is provided by the strict rules of the FAA and constant necessity to renew the elements of the old planes, yet, the situation in the market suffers because of the stigma of constant deficit of qualified maintenance specialists.

  • Europe

Europe is a very advanced and developed MRO market, which exploits the close continuum of large airlines and global third-party MRO giants, including those in Germany and the Netherlands. Complex engine and avionics maintenance needed to service the large Airbus and Boeing fleets serves the continent-wide component MRO demand. Lasting market concern is sustainability, with the suppliers putting a lot of emphasis on repair and refurbishment of components, extending their life and complying with the very strict EASA environmental guidelines.                                                 

  • Asia

The Asia Pacific market is fast developing as the fastest growing market in the world in terms of Aircraft Component MRO. Massive fleet growth in the countries such as China and India, strong air traffic growth and heavy government investments geared towards the development of local MRO capabilities contribute to this acceleration. The market is emerging, but fast becoming a global center as more places such as Singapore continue to leverage their strategic location and develop their capacity often by joint venture and collaboration with other world OEMs to satisfy the growing localized component maintenance requirements.

KEY INDUSTRY DEVELOPMENT

March 2023: Lufthansa Technik (Germany) released its bold "Ambition 2030" boom application in 2023, committing massive funding to solidify its worldwide leadership inside the factor MRO market. This approach includes a chief focus at the vertical integration of services and the growth of its core enterprise into high-increase regions like North America and Asia-Pacific. Key tasks involve increasing service locations, such as new component and engine shops in Canada and Portugal, and heavily making an investment in virtual business fashions just like the AVIATAR platform to enhance predictive preservation talents for airways worldwide.
